Is 249 438 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 249 438 is about 499.438.

Thus, the square root of 249 438 is not an integer, and therefore 249 438 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 249 438?

The square of a number (here 249 438) is the result of the product of this number (249 438) by itself (i.e., 249 438 × 249 438); the square of 249 438 is sometimes called "raising 249 438 to the power 2", or "249 438 squared".

The square of 249 438 is 62 219 315 844 because 249 438 × 249 438 = 249 4382 = 62 219 315 844.

As a consequence, 249 438 is the square root of 62 219 315 844.
